    Danylo Lazariev – Cycle “States of Soul and Body” for solo cimbalom

    “States of Soul and Body” for solo cimbalom is a cycle united by a single idea. Cimbalom players have a very limited repertoire in contemporary classical music, particularly in the contemporary genre. There are precedents in world music where composers who are not cimbalom players, such as György Kurtág or Zoltán Kodály, have written for solo cimbalom or included it in ensembles. For instance, there is the Suite by Henri Dutilleux for strings and cimbalom. Abroad, the cimbalom is no longer perceived purely as a folk instrument, but in Ukraine, there is still a certain aura surrounding it. It is quite peculiar, considering the instrument’s wide range of capabilities and its ambiguous sound.

    In this composition, the composer attempted to streamline everything into one technique, in this case, the twelve-tone technique, a 12-tone system developed by composers of the New Viennese School. The author also applied an unconventional approach to the cimbalom’s sound – a preparation. It was necessary for the cimbalom to produce sounds in an atypical manner. The result of this mix of experiments is manifested in a suite for solo cimbalom with four parts: “Reflections,” “Movements,” “Questions,” and “Variations.” The music reflects various states of the soul and how they influence the body. This can be seen as an allusion to the saying “a healthy mind in a healthy body,” but here it is transformed into “an unhealthy body, an unhealthy spirit.”
